Research Paper (postgraduate) from the year 2015 in the subject Business economics - Business Management, Corporate Governance, University of Bradford (BCID), course: MSc in Project Planning and Management, language: English, abstract: A development project is based on its contribution, on definite events, and on production which are projected to add to the preferred purposes and ultimate goal. The aims of the development assistance projects are poverty alleviation, improvement of living standards, environment protection, human rights protection etc. The rationale of development projects is to persuade transform whose consequences are most wanted within the limited scope. The main idea of this research is to assess the application of the OOPP approach for contributing the design and delivery of development assistance projects. The report covers the logical steps of OOPP approach and stages of project design with a conceptual framework, the critical assessment of extent of OOPP approach for design and delivery, and the criticisms of OOPP approach in development assistance project planning and execution.

Mr. M A Salam is working as Senior Assistant Secretary in Ministry of Public Administration, Government of Bangladesh since June 2014. He did B Sc (Hons) and M Sc in Zoology from Jahangirnagar University; M A in Governance and Development from BRAC University, Bangladesh and attained highest position in all occasions. Now, he is pursuing M Sc in Project Planning and Management at University of Bradford, United Kingdom.
